The Repair Process

When you bring your laptop in for screen repair, the technician will typically start with a diagnosis to identify the issue accurately. This might involve checking the hardware components and running software tests to pinpoint the problem. Once the assessment is complete, the technician will discuss the findings with you and provide a quote for the repair costs.

Following your approval, the actual repair work can commence. This involves disassembling the laptop carefully to replace the damaged screen. Technicians use specialised tools to ensure precision during this process. After replacing the screen, the laptop is reassembled and tested to confirm that everything is functioning correctly before being returned to you.

Steps Involved in Getting Your Laptop Screen Fixed

When your laptop screen sustains damage, the first step typically involves assessing the extent of the problem. Checking for visible cracks or significant issues can help determine whether a simple repair or a complete screen replacement is necessary. If the device still powers on, taking note of any display irregularities, such as flickering or colour distortions, is essential. This assessment can also involve gathering information about the laptop's make and model, as these details will guide the technician in identifying the compatible replacement parts.

After evaluating the damage, the next step usually includes reaching out to a repair service or technician. Many businesses in Sydney offer quick assessments, often providing same-day service for urgent cases. During this initial contact, you should share the observations made during your assessment. Once you hand over the laptop, technicians will usually run their diagnostics to confirm the issues and discuss potential repair options, including timelines and costs. This transparency ensures that you remain informed throughout the repair process.

Warranty and Guarantee on Repairs

When getting your laptop screen repaired, it's essential to understand the warranty and guarantee policies offered by repair shops. Many professional services provide a warranty that covers parts and labour for a specified period following the repair. This guarantee assures customers that if any issues arise related to the repair, the service centre will address them at no additional cost, demonstrating accountability and a commitment to quality.

Customers should carefully review the terms of the warranty before proceeding. Some shops may offer limited warranties that exclude specific types of damage or may only cover defects in the replacement parts. It is crucial to clarify the details to avoid misunderstandings later. Familiarity with these policies will enable you to make informed decisions, ensuring that your investment in repairs is protected.

Understanding Your Rights and Options

When seeking laptop screen repairs, customers should be aware of their rights under consumer protection laws. In Australia, these laws ensure that repairs are carried out with quality service and materials. If a repair does not meet acceptable standards, you have the right to ask for a refund or further remedial action. Always keep receipts and records related to the service for reference, as this documentation will support any claim you need to make regarding quality standards.

It's important to clarify warranty conditions when you opt for repairs. Many repair services offer guarantees on their work, usually ranging from a few months to a year. Understanding the specifics of these warranties can save you from unexpected costs in the future. Don’t hesitate to ask questions about what is covered and for how long, as this knowledge will help you make informed decisions and protect your investment.

DIY Repairs

Choosing to fix your laptop screen yourself can be both rewarding and challenging. Many online resources provide detailed guides and video tutorials that can assist in the process. You will need the right tools, including screwdrivers and replacement parts, which are often available through online retailers or local electronics stores. Prior research can help you identify the type of screen your laptop requires, ensuring you purchase the correct replacement.

However, it’s essential to weigh the risks involved in a DIY repair. Incorrect installation can lead to further damage, possibly voiding any existing warranty. If your laptop has sensitive components, extra care is necessary to avoid accidental harm. For those comfortable with technology and willing to take the chance, self-repair can save time and money while providing a sense of accomplishment.

Tools and Resources for Self-Repair

If you're considering tackling a laptop screen repair on your own, having the right tools is essential. You'll typically need a set of precision screwdrivers, which often include Phillips and Torx types, to safely access the various components of your device. A plastic spudger can help pry open the casing without causing damage. Additionally, using an anti-static wrist strap can protect sensitive components from static electricity while you work.

Numerous online resources provide guides and tutorials that can be invaluable for DIY repairs. Websites like iFixit offer step-by-step instructions for a range of laptop models, often with helpful diagrams. Video platforms also host a plethora of instructional videos demonstrating the repair process in real-time. Familiarising yourself with these resources can make a significant difference in your confidence and success when attempting the repair.

FAQS

How long does it typically take to repair a laptop screen in Sydney?

The repair time can vary depending on the extent of the damage and the availability of parts, but most urgent repairs can be completed within a few hours to a day.

What should I do if my laptop screen is cracked?

If your laptop screen is cracked, it's best to take it to a professional repair service as soon as possible to prevent further damage and ensure proper repair.

Are there any warranties on laptop screen repairs?

Yes, many repair services offer warranties on their work, which can vary in length and coverage. It's recommended to ask about warranty details before proceeding with any repairs.

Can I attempt to fix my laptop screen myself?

While DIY repairs are possible, they can be risky and may void your warranty. If you have the necessary tools and experience, it might be worth trying, but professional assistance is often the safer option.

What tools do I need for a DIY laptop screen repair?

For a DIY laptop screen repair, you typically need a set of precision screwdrivers, a plastic spudger, and possibly adhesive. It's essential to research your specific laptop model for any additional tools required.
